  • Die Forelle★ Michelin Nothing could make more sense here in the picturesque Weissensee Nature Park than to align the kitchen philosophy with the natural surroundings. In his six-course "BERG.SEE." menu, chef-patron Hannes Müller showcases a personal, ingredient-driven style – top quality guaranteed. Much of what is served originates from the restaurant's own farm or trusted local producers.   • Rouge Noir★ Michelin First things first: make sure you have some time to play with! Stefan Glantschnig and his team take you on a culinary journey around and through the Weissensee region. In a tasting menu comprising 12 beautifully coordinated, creative courses, top-notch ingredients from the immediate vicinity are showcased through exciting flavour combinations. The Chef's Table, limited to eight diners, is not in the kitchen but in a private room on the first floor of the Neusacherhof hotel.   • Bärenwirt Claudia and Manuel Ressi bring warmth and dedication to the running of this charming restaurant on the main square. The cuisine showcases select regional ingredients, which are presented in a kind of hybrid concept. On the one hand, there are the Austrian "Wirtshaus-Klassiker" à la carte (including Wiener schnitzel, Tafelspitz, Gailtaler Ripperl, and Backhendl), and then there is the four- to eight-course "Bärenwanderung" set menu with creative, modern dishes such as "Hühnerhof – organic chicken, beans, wild mushrooms, savory, buckwheat".   • Wirtshaus by Stefan Glantschnig In addition to gorgeous hotel rooms and the upscale second restaurant, Rouge Noir, Neusacherhof is also home to Wirtshaus, where chef Stefan Glantschnig and his team put a contemporary spin on classic regional dishes. Their traditional character is deliberately retained while being cleverly enhanced with flavourful and visually appealing touches. In addition to the à la carte selection, there are daily specials – for those who find it difficult to choose, a surprise menu compiled from those options is available.   • Das Loewenzahn There are several reasons why you feel at home here: first, there is the charming decor, which is fresh and contemporary yet retains a certain regional flavour, plus the terrace with a lovely view over the lake. Secondly, the food – you can expect cuisine that, although of a regional bent, is also open to international influences. Served in the form of a five- to eight-course set menu, the dishes, such as "octopus, cauliflower, Amalfi lemon, saffron" or "lamb, meadow herbs, tomato, romaine lettuce", always have a modern, creative twist.
